ASP应用安全:防范漏洞的策略与实践

AI绘图结果,仅供参考

ASP(Active Server Pages)作为一种早期的动态网页技术,虽然已经被更现代的框架所取代,但在一些遗留系统中仍然广泛使用。由于其设计和实现方式,ASP应用容易成为安全漏洞的高发区。

常见的ASP安全问题包括SQL注入、跨站脚本(XSS)、路径遍历攻击以及会话管理不当等。这些问题往往源于开发人员对输入验证和输出编码的忽视,或是对服务器配置不够严谨。

为了防范这些漏洞,开发者应严格校验所有用户输入,避免直接拼接SQL语句,而是使用参数化查询或存储过程来处理数据库操作。同时,对输出内容进行适当的编码,防止恶意脚本被注入到页面中。

另外,合理配置服务器和应用程序的安全设置也是关键。例如,关闭不必要的服务、限制文件访问权限、使用HTTPS加密通信等,都能有效降低攻击面。

定期进行安全测试和代码审查也是保障ASP应用安全的重要手段。通过自动化工具和手动检查,可以及时发现并修复潜在的安全隐患。

最终,提升开发团队的安全意识和技术能力,是构建安全ASP应用的根本保障。只有将安全融入开发流程,才能真正实现系统的长期稳定运行。

关于作者: dawei

【声明】:杭州站长网内容转载自互联网,其相关言论仅代表作者个人观点绝非权威,不代表本站立场。如您发现内容存在版权问题,请提交相关链接至邮箱:bqsm@foxmail.com,我们将及时予以处理。

为您推荐